The discussion also turned to the performance of Jaden Daniels, the Commanders' quarterback. Olsen revealed that Daniels appeared healthier compared to previous weeks, suggesting that the team was becoming more comfortable with him as a designed runner. However, the Commanders still struggled with their ability to push the ball downfield effectively. Olsen noted the importance of employing a more aggressive passing strategy earlier in games rather than waiting until a crisis strikes.
